Physical Address

304 North Cardinal St.
Dorchester Center, MA 02124

From Firewalls to Backups: Understanding Security Features in WordPress Hosting

WordPress is one of the most popular content management systems (CMS) in the world, powering millions of websites. However, its popularity also makes it a prime target for hackers and cybercriminals. This is why security should be a top priority for anyone hosting a WordPress website.

The potential risks and threats to WordPress websites are numerous. Hackers can exploit vulnerabilities in outdated plugins or themes, gain unauthorized access to the website, inject malicious code, or even bring down the entire site with a distributed denial of service (DDoS) attack. These threats can lead to data breaches, loss of sensitive information, damage to reputation, and financial loss.

Key Takeaways

  • Firewalls are an essential security measure for WordPress hosting, as they can block malicious traffic and prevent unauthorized access.
  • SSL certificates are crucial for securing data transmission between a website and its visitors, as they encrypt sensitive information.
  • DDoS attacks can be mitigated in WordPress hosting through measures such as rate limiting and traffic filtering.
  • Malware scanning and removal is important for detecting and removing malicious code that can compromise a website’s security.
  • Two-factor authentication adds an extra layer of security to WordPress hosting by requiring users to provide a second form of identification in addition to a password.

Understanding Firewalls in WordPress Hosting

A firewall is a security measure that acts as a barrier between your website and potential threats from the internet. It monitors incoming and outgoing network traffic and blocks any suspicious or malicious activity. In WordPress hosting, firewalls play a crucial role in protecting your website from unauthorized access and attacks.

There are two types of firewalls commonly used in WordPress hosting: network firewalls and application firewalls. Network firewalls are typically implemented at the server level and filter traffic based on IP addresses, ports, and protocols. Application firewalls, on the other hand, are installed as plugins within WordPress and provide an additional layer of protection by monitoring and filtering HTTP requests.

Setting up and configuring a firewall for WordPress hosting is relatively straightforward. Many web hosting providers offer built-in firewall solutions that can be easily enabled through their control panels. Additionally, there are several popular firewall plugins available for WordPress that can be installed and configured with just a few clicks.

The Role of SSL Certificates in WordPress Hosting Security

SSL (Secure Sockets Layer) certificates are cryptographic protocols that encrypt the data transmitted between a user’s browser and your website’s server. They play a crucial role in securing WordPress websites by ensuring that sensitive information such as login credentials, credit card details, and personal data is transmitted securely.

Using SSL certificates for WordPress hosting offers several benefits. Firstly, it helps establish trust with your website visitors by displaying a padlock icon in the browser’s address bar, indicating that the connection is secure. This can increase user confidence and reduce the risk of data breaches.

Secondly, SSL certificates are now a ranking factor in Google’s search algorithm. Websites that use SSL certificates are more likely to rank higher in search engine results, leading to increased visibility and organic traffic.

Installing and configuring an SSL certificate for WordPress hosting is a relatively simple process. Many web hosting providers offer free SSL certificates through services like Let’s Encrypt. Alternatively, you can purchase an SSL certificate from a trusted certificate authority and install it manually on your server.

DDoS Mitigation in WordPress Hosting

A distributed denial of service (DDoS) attack is a malicious attempt to disrupt the normal functioning of a website by overwhelming it with a flood of fake traffic. DDoS attacks can cause websites to become slow or completely unresponsive, leading to loss of revenue and damage to reputation.

Mitigating DDoS attacks in WordPress hosting requires a multi-layered approach. Firstly, it is important to choose a web hosting provider that offers DDoS protection as part of their hosting package. These providers have specialized infrastructure and technologies in place to detect and mitigate DDoS attacks before they reach your website.

Additionally, you can use plugins or services specifically designed for DDoS protection in WordPress. These plugins monitor incoming traffic and block any suspicious or malicious requests. They can also distribute the traffic across multiple servers or cloud-based networks to handle large-scale attacks.

Malware Scanning and Removal in WordPress Hosting

Malware refers to any malicious software that is designed to gain unauthorized access to a computer system or cause harm. In the context of WordPress hosting, malware can infect your website and compromise its security, leading to data breaches, defacement, or even complete loss of control.

Scanning and removing malware from WordPress hosting is essential to maintain the security and integrity of your website. There are several techniques you can use to accomplish this. Firstly, you can use security plugins that offer malware scanning and removal features. These plugins scan your website’s files and database for any signs of malware and provide options to remove or quarantine the infected files.

Additionally, you can use external malware scanning services that specialize in WordPress security. These services scan your website remotely and provide detailed reports on any malware or vulnerabilities found. They can also offer recommendations on how to fix the issues and prevent future infections.

Two-Factor Authentication in WordPress Hosting

Two-factor authentication (2FA) adds an extra layer of security to your WordPress website by requiring users to provide two forms of identification before gaining access. This typically involves something the user knows (such as a password) and something the user has (such as a mobile device).

Setting up and configuring two-factor authentication for WordPress hosting is relatively simple. There are several plugins available that can add 2FA functionality to your login page. These plugins typically support a variety of authentication methods, including SMS codes, email verification, or time-based one-time passwords (TOTP).

Best practices for using two-factor authentication in WordPress hosting include enabling it for all user accounts, including administrators and contributors. It is also recommended to use a strong password in combination with 2FA for maximum security.

Regular Software Updates in WordPress Hosting Security

Regular software updates are crucial for maintaining the security of your WordPress hosting environment. This includes updating the core WordPress software, as well as any themes or plugins installed on your website.

Keeping WordPress and its plugins up to date offers several benefits. Firstly, it ensures that you have the latest security patches and bug fixes installed, reducing the risk of vulnerabilities being exploited by hackers. Secondly, updates often include new features and improvements that can enhance the functionality and performance of your website.

Setting up automatic software updates for WordPress hosting is recommended to ensure that you never miss an important update. Many web hosting providers offer this feature as part of their hosting packages. Alternatively, you can use plugins that provide automatic update functionality for WordPress and its plugins.

Backups and Disaster Recovery in WordPress Hosting

Backups and disaster recovery are essential components of any WordPress hosting security strategy. They allow you to restore your website to a previous state in the event of a security breach, data loss, or other catastrophic events.

There are several techniques you can use to back up and restore your WordPress website. Firstly, you can use backup plugins that automate the process of creating backups and storing them securely. These plugins typically offer options for scheduling regular backups, choosing what to include in the backup (files, database, or both), and storing the backups on remote servers or cloud storage platforms.

Additionally, many web hosting providers offer backup services as part of their hosting packages. These services often include features such as one-click restores, incremental backups (only backing up changes since the last backup), and offsite storage for added security.

User Access Management in WordPress Hosting

User access management is an important aspect of WordPress hosting security. It involves controlling who has access to your website’s backend and what permissions they have.

There are several techniques you can use to manage user access in WordPress hosting. Firstly, it is important to create strong passwords for all user accounts and enforce password complexity rules. This helps prevent unauthorized access through brute force attacks.

Additionally, you can use user role management plugins to assign specific roles and permissions to different user accounts. This allows you to control what actions each user can perform on your website, such as creating or editing content, installing plugins, or modifying settings.

Best practices for user access management in WordPress hosting include regularly reviewing and updating user accounts to remove any unnecessary or inactive accounts. It is also recommended to enable two-factor authentication for all user accounts, as discussed earlier.

The Importance of Prioritizing Security in WordPress Hosting

In conclusion, security should be a top priority for anyone hosting a WordPress website. The potential risks and threats to WordPress websites are numerous, ranging from unauthorized access and data breaches to DDoS attacks and malware infections.

To ensure the security of your WordPress hosting environment, it is important to implement a multi-layered approach that includes firewalls, SSL certificates, DDoS mitigation, malware scanning and removal, two-factor authentication, regular software updates, backups and disaster recovery, and user access management.

By prioritizing security and implementing these measures, you can protect your website from potential threats and ensure the safety of your data and your users’ information. Don’t wait until it’s too late – take action now to secure your WordPress hosting environment.

If you’re interested in learning more about preventing WordPress website hacks, check out this informative article on How to Prevent WordPress Website Hack from Hacker. It provides valuable insights and practical tips to safeguard your WordPress site from potential security breaches. Understanding the tactics used by hackers can help you take proactive measures to protect your website and ensure its security.

FAQs

What is WordPress hosting?

WordPress hosting is a type of web hosting that is specifically optimized for WordPress websites. It typically includes features such as automatic WordPress updates, enhanced security, and specialized support.

What are firewalls in WordPress hosting?

Firewalls are security measures that help protect WordPress websites from unauthorized access and attacks. They work by monitoring incoming and outgoing traffic and blocking any suspicious activity.

What are backups in WordPress hosting?

Backups are copies of a WordPress website’s files and data that are stored in a secure location. They are used to restore a website in the event of data loss or corruption.

What is SSL in WordPress hosting?

SSL (Secure Sockets Layer) is a security protocol that encrypts data transmitted between a website and its visitors. It helps protect sensitive information such as login credentials and payment details.

What is malware scanning in WordPress hosting?

Malware scanning is a process that checks a WordPress website for any malicious software or code that could harm the site or its visitors. It helps identify and remove any threats before they can cause damage.

What is two-factor authentication in WordPress hosting?

Two-factor authentication is a security feature that requires users to provide two forms of identification before accessing a WordPress website. This helps prevent unauthorized access and protects sensitive information.

Leave a Reply